The invitation

  • You can invite participants by sending them the test link via email, Slack, company intranet, instant messenger, etc.
  • Include any information you'd like to share along with the link to grant them access to the test.
    • In the Classic UserTesting experience: An email template is provided when you create the test. You can also include the UserTesting Terms of Use.

UserTesting app installation

  • If your participants are using a desktop:
    • They do not need to download anything if taking a test in the UserTesting Classic experience.
    • In the New UserTesting experience, participants will need to install the UserTesting Browser Recorder Extension (the test will prompt them to do this).

  • If your participants are using a mobile device: 
    • They will need to install the UserTesting mobile app for their iOS or Android device.
    • After a participants clicks the test link, they'll be guided through the appropriate steps.

Testing experience

  • Regardless of test type or device, all Invite Network participants go through the same pre-test setup before their session begins. 
  • They'll receive brief tips on using the recorder, disabling notifications, and setting up their microphone. Once setup is complete, the experience varies depending on the test type they've been invited to take. 
  • After any test type, participants are thanked for their time and notified that their session has been submitted.
     

     

Think-out-loud experience

  • In a think-out-loud test, participants complete a series of tasks while narrating their thoughts, reactions, and decisions as they go. 
  • Depending on if the participant is taking a Classic think-out-loud or a New think-out-loud test, on desktop or on mobile, the experience will differ slightly.

Desktop experience

  • Desktop participants on the UserTesting Classic experience don't need to download anything. The seamless recorder lets them click the test link and begin immediately, recording their screen and audio through the browser. 
  • Participants using the Classic experience use the "two tab" experience: one tab for the task instructions, and another tab for the test experience.
  • Desktop participants on the UserTesting New experience will be prompted to install the UserTesting Browser Recorder Extension.
  • Participants using the New experience will complete their test all within the same browser tab.

Mobile experience

  • Regardless of which recorder version a participant encounters, mobile participants will need to install the UserTesting app for iOS or Android before they can begin. 
  • After clicking the test link, they'll be guided through the appropriate download steps automatically.

Interaction test experience

  • The test setup follows the same flow as any test type in the New experience.
  • In an interaction test, participants are given a specific task to complete. 
  • They attempt the task on a live website or prototype while thinking out loud, and the recorder captures their screen and audio throughout.
  • Each task is presented one at a time with a clear prompt. Participants are encouraged to narrate what they're looking for, what they notice, and what they'd expect to happen as they click through.
  • The flow is similar to the updated think-out-loud (see previous section).

Survey experience

  • The test setup follows the same flow as any test type in the New experience.
  • In a survey test, participants answer a series of questions rather than completing tasks on a website or prototype. Questions may include multiple choice, rating scales (such as a 1–10 numeric scale or a 5-star rating), and open-text responses.
  • Participants move through questions one at a time using Next and Back buttons. A progress indicator shows them how far along they are. The Next button remains inactive until they've answered the current question, so no responses can be accidentally skipped.
  • Survey tests are available on both desktop and mobile and do not require screen recording or audio. Participants complete surveys entirely within the browser or the UserTesting app.

Troubleshooting

Update browser extension

  • If a participant has taken a test with UserTesting before, they may encounter a message prompting them to update the browser extension.

  • If the update is not successful, the participant can remove the extension from their browser.

  • They may need to exit the test setup flow and reenter it again. They should then see a step to install the extension.

  • Follow the instructions to install the extension. The step will update to show that the extension has been successfully installed.
